2026 Unifor National Scholarship Application period is OPEN!

Unifor recognizes that the cost associated with post-secondary education is a challenge for many working families. To assist in making education more accessible, we have established 23 scholarships of $2,000 each to children of Unifor members and a Unifor member entering their first year of post-secondary studies. Earth Day proposal for April 19/26 Union meeting – Bring your E-Waste to the Next Union Meeting

The Unifor Local 707 Environment Standing Committee has developed a proposal to honour Earth Day (Wednesday April 22/26) at our Union meeting on April 19/26. Opening door to Chinese EV risks future of Canada’s auto sector

January 16, 2026 TORONTO–The Canadian government’s decision to open the door to China-owned EV imports poses extreme risk to Canadian auto jobs and the future of our entire auto sector. “This is a self-inflicted wound to an already injured Canadian auto industry,” said Unifor National President Lana Payne. “Providing a foothold to cheap Chinese EVs, […]
